From f1ec542841bfdaf1aae771836855ae8399500eaa Mon Sep 17 00:00:00 2001 From: senilio Date: Tue, 7 Nov 2023 21:57:45 +0100 Subject: [PATCH] Compile --- .github/workflows/build.yaml |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index 57be2eb..d7a094b 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-21,8 +21,17 @@ jobs: container: dockcross/${{ matrix.toolchain }}:latest steps: - uses: actions/checkout@v4 - - name: Compile project - run: | + - run: | + apt-get install -y autoconf-archive + wget https://git.kernel.org/pub/scm/libs/libgpiod/libgpiod.git/snapshot/libgpiod-1.6.4.tar.gz + tar xvf libgpiod-1.6.4.tar.gz + cd libgpiod-1.6.4 + ./autogen.sh --enable-tools=yes + make + make install + ls -Rl + + - run: | cmake -B build . cmake --build build mv build/GCFFlasher GCFFlasher-${{ matrix.toolchain }}